Biotechnology is a rapidly growing field in India, with its scope expanding across multiple industries such as agriculture, healthcare, food processing, and environmental conservation. Biotechnology involves using living organisms or their derivatives to create products or processes that improve the quality of life.

 

The Indian biotech industry has witnessed significant growth over the past few years, with the sector estimated to be worth around USD 70 billion by 2025. India has also become a preferred destination for clinical trials, with its large patient population and low-cost advantage.

 

The agricultural sector is one of the primary beneficiaries of biotechnology in India. Biotech innovations such as genetically modified crops, biofertilizers, and biopesticides have helped increase crop yields, reduce costs, and improve food security. India is among the top ten countries in the world in terms of biotech crop cultivation, with crops such as cotton, brinjal, and mustard being genetically modified to increase their resistance to pests and diseases.

The healthcare industry in India is another major beneficiary of biotechnology. The country has a thriving pharmaceutical industry that manufactures generic drugs, and biotechnology has helped in the development of new drugs, vaccines, and therapies. Biotech products such as recombinant DNA products, monoclonal antibodies, and biosimilars have revolutionized the treatment of various diseases such as cancer, diabetes, and rheumatoid arthritis.

The food processing industry in India is also benefiting from biotechnology. Biotech innovations such as food enzymes, probiotics, and prebiotics have helped improve the quality and safety of food products. Biotech-based food processing methods such as fermentation have also helped in the preservation of food and the production of new food products.

 

Environmental conservation is another area where biotechnology is making significant contributions in India. Bioremediation, which involves using microorganisms to clean up contaminated soil and water, has helped in the restoration of degraded ecosystems. Biotech innovations such as bioplastics, which are biodegradable and compostable, have also helped in reducing plastic waste.

The Indian government has been promoting the growth of the biotech industry through various initiatives such as the Biotechnology Industry Partnership Programme, the Biotechnology Ignition Grant, and the Biotechnology Industry Research Assistance Council. These initiatives have helped in the development of a robust biotech ecosystem in the country, with a focus on research and development, innovation, and entrepreneurship.

 

Courses Available:

 

Biotechnology courses are available at both undergraduate and postgraduate levels in India. The most popular courses include Bachelor of Science (B.Sc.) in Biotechnology, Bachelor of Technology (B.Tech.) in Biotechnology, Master of Science (M.Sc.) in Biotechnology, and Master of Technology (M.Tech.) in Biotechnology. There are also specialized courses such as Diploma in Biotechnology, Postgraduate Diploma in Biotechnology, and Ph.D. in Biotechnology.

 

The curriculum of biotechnology courses in India includes subjects such as microbiology, molecular biology, genetic engineering, biochemistry, biostatistics, and bioinformatics. The courses also involve practical training and research projects to provide hands-on experience to the students.

 

Career Prospects:

 

Biotechnology offers a vast range of career opportunities in various industries. Some of the popular career options include:

 

  • 1- Research Scientist: Biotech research scientists work in laboratories to develop new products or processes. They conduct experiments, analyze data, and develop new technologies.
  • 2- Biotech Engineer: Biotech engineers design and develop equipment and processes to help in the production of biotech products.
  • 3- Biotech Sales Representative: Biotech sales representatives promote biotech products to potential customers and educate them about the benefits of the products.
  • 4- Regulatory Affairs Manager: Regulatory affairs managers ensure that biotech products meet regulatory requirements and guidelines.
  • 5- Biotech Patent Lawyer: Biotech patent lawyers specialize in biotech patent laws and help companies protect their intellectual property rights.



Top Colleges:

 

India has several top-rated colleges and universities offering biotechnology courses. Some of the top colleges for biotechnology study in India are:

 

  • 1- Indian Institute of Technology (IIT) - Delhi, Kharagpur, Bombay, Kanpur, and Madras.
  • 2- Jawaharlal Nehru University (JNU) - New Delhi.
  • 3- All India Institute of Medical Sciences (AIIMS) - New Delhi.
  • 4- National Institute of Technology (NIT) - Warangal, Rourkela, and Trichy.
  • 5- Institute of Chemical Technology (ICT) - Mumbai.
  • 6- University of Delhi (DU) - New Delhi.
  • 7- Anna University - Chennai.
